Problems solved by technology

If the transformer is short-circuited, the impedance of the coil will disappear, so that the output voltage will be 0, and the voltage of the primary coil will be zero. Since the excitation inductance and the ideal transformer are connected in parallel, the voltage of the excitation inductance will also be zero, and the excitation inductance of volt-seconds will be lost. The core can no longer be magnetized, the excitation inductance disappears, the excitation flux disappears, the primary side coil becomes a different line, the primary side voltage is all added to the leakage inductance, the current will increase sharply, and a short circuit current occurs
Once the secondary side is short-circuited, the primary side is "reflected short-circuited", the voltage relationship ratio disappears, the short-circuit current tends to be infinite, and the transformer will be burned

Abstract

The invention discloses a transformer short circuit detection system, which comprises an inductance detection unit, a microcontroller and a short circuit protection unit, the inductance detection unitis connected with the microcontroller, the microcontroller is connected with the short circuit protection unit, and the inductance detection unit consists of a universal meter and a calculation unit.The invention further discloses a detection method of the transformer short circuit detection system. The inductance detection unit is used for measuring the inductance of a coil in the transformer in real time and transmitting the inductance to the microcontroller, and when the inductance in the coil is instantaneously and greatly reduced, the microcontroller judges that the transformer has a short-circuit fault and drives the short-circuit protection unit to carry out short-circuit protection on the transformer.

technical field [0001] The invention belongs to the technical field of electronic equipment detection, and relates to a transformer short-circuit detection system and a detection method. Background technique [0002] Transformer is a device that uses the principle of electromagnetic induction to change AC voltage. The main components are primary coil, secondary coil and iron core (magnetic core). The main functions are: voltage transformation, current transformation, impedance transformation, isolation, voltage stabilization (magnetic saturation transformer), etc. According to the use, it can be divided into: power transformers and special transformers (electric furnace transformers, rectifier transformers, power frequency test transformers, voltage regulators, mining transformers, audio transformers, intermediate frequency transformers, high frequency transformers, impact transformers, instrument transformers, electronic transformers , reactors, transformers, etc.).
